After 30 years and educating over 1.4 million professionals, Lorman knows that continuing education does not always happen Monday-Friday from 8:00 am-5:00 pm. They understand your need for concise, accurate and timely information that impacts your business and clients. Lorman Education Services accommodates your needs by offering live webinars and on-demand products on regulations, laws and business changes. Lorman partnered with Machintel in 2016 to conduct a lead generation campaign before the launch of a live webinar, “What Contractors Need to Know about OCIPs and CCIPs" in order to boost attendance and product sales.

The target audiences included C-suite executives and managers in Real Estate, Development, and Construction companies across the US with revenues of 100 million and above. The preferred marketing methods were email marketing and content syndication across a variety of channels, including a successful social media component. Lorman provided the webinar information and its associated products for promotion.

The Real Estate Report, Machintel’s publication for decision-makers in Construction and Real Estate, and its associated social media communities were used to engage the target audiences with Lorman's product information. All micro-site visitors were retargeted to enhance product awareness.

The campaigns achieved high levels of engagement, experienced repeat interactions with potential customers through retargeting, completed on-time delivery of leads, and achieved 100% acceptance rates of the MOL leads generated.
